I'm looking for information on Alexander Murray Boyd. He was born 19th February 1892 in Scotland and emigrated to Australia around 1912. He enlisted in the Australian Imperial Force in 1915 and fought in France during WW1. He returned to Australia in 1917 where he died in 1940.

Any other information would be much appreciated.

GlasgowLass

GlasgowLass Report 29 Jun 2012 17:20

According to his 1940 death index in Ancestry, his parents were called Alexander Boyd and Ann.
His funeral notice also appears in the Sydney Morning Herald of 22nd and 23rd May 1940, husband of Eileen Elizabeth

However, assuming this full name was on entered his birth record, there is only one matching birth. This birth was registered in Libberton, Midlothian (Edinburgh City) in 1892

I cannot locate an Alexander Boyd in 1901 with parents named Alexander and Ann

The above Alexander Boyd seems also to have served with the Australia Forces during WW1. His service record gives his next of kin as his brother, W. Boyd, Blackford Glen, Liberton

http://recordsearch.naa.gov.au/scripts/Imagine.asp?B=3105201


EDIT

On Page 11 (of 28) of his records his brother's address is Bleachford Glen, Liberton.

His record also says he lost the third, fourth and fifth digit of his right hand.

Again from the records Alexander Boyd was living at 192 Albion Street, Sydney in November 1926.

Assuming we definitely have the same person, Alexander's parents would have been William and Jessie.
I wonder why they are listed as Alexander and Ann on the death index?

past63 may need to obtain a copy of the birh record to confirm.

I suspect he was the son of William Boyd and Janet (jessie) Murray who married in Newton, Midlothian in 1889.
As 2nd son, he would be usually be named for his maternal grandfather (Alexander Murray?)

Alexander Murray Boyd can be found on all electoral rolls between 1916 and 1937.
1916 he is a miner lving in Kalgoorlie and there is no one else called Boyd in the household.

1925 in Perth is the odd one.... living at 167 Newcastle Street and there is a Daisy Dent Boyd at the same address.
Daisy Dent Boyd can be found all all electoral rolls in Perth until 1963 and there is no Alexander in the household

1930-1937 Alexander Murray Boyd lives with his wife Eileen Elizabeth in Sydney
1937-1958 widow Eileen Elizabeth is still found in Sydney, latterly living with her son also named Alexander Murray Boyd

The birth that Anne found on SP

Alexander Murray Boyd born at 8h. 10m PM on 19 February 1892 at Tudhills, Liberton. Father William Boyd, Traction Engine Driver and Jessie Boyd maiden surname Murray were married 7th June 1889 at Newton. Father William Boyd was the informant.

Parents marriage

William Boyd formerly Scott, father John Scott, Gardiner mother Agnes Rankin maiden surname Boyd. Janet Murray father Alexander Murray, Ploughman mother Margaret Murray maiden surname Baillie. None of parents noted as deceased.

Now Janet Boyd ms Murray died as the Widow of William Boyd in 1941. Her death was registered by her son William Boyd. Now why wasn't she Alexander's next of kin when he enlisted? Could he have fallen out with his parents and that's why their names are incorrect on his death certificate? Perhaps he never spoke about them. In the passing William Boyd gives the wrong name for his maternal grandmother on Janet's death. He has her as JANET Bailley.

The Western Australia ( Perth) sat 5 Oct 1918 page 1

Marriages:
BOYD-GREENE. On Jul 24 at Church of England by the Rev W Patrick, Seargent A.W Boyd DCM ( returned), second son of Mr and Mrs W Boyd, Edinburgh, Scotland to Daisy Dent Greene, youngest daughter of Mrs S J Greene and the late J A Greene 173 Newcastle Street, Perth
